The Opportunity
The purpose of this role as Senior Full Stack Engineer is to design and ship
end-to-end features across our AI governance platform — from a scalable Python
backend on AWS through to the TypeScript/React front-end that gives users clarity and
control.
This is a hands-on, high-impact individual-contributor role at the centre of a
fast-moving start-up: you’ll own features from concept to production, make pragmatic
architectural decisions, and translate complex, governance-led product thinking into a
platform that is scalable, secure and trustworthy for the business customers who rely on
it.
You will report to the Director of Technology and work in close, day-to-day collaboration
with the Lead Developer, the UI/UX Lead and the wider engineering team — pairing
engineering and design closely together to underpin the rapid launch and development
of our AI-native service.
You’ll be joining early enough to shape not just the platform, but
how engineering happens.

Key Responsibilities
● Design, build and ship full-stack features — a scalable, secure Python backend
on AWS and a polished TypeScript/React front-end.
● Work hands-on with our cloud infrastructure (Terraform, Kubernetes, EKS) to
deploy and operate the services you build.
● Use harness-based, AI-assisted development workflows — running Claude Code
or similar coding agents in automated loops to handle the majority (80%+) of the
SDLC, from planning through implementation, testing, and review.
● Partner closely with the UI/UX Lead to turn designs into responsive, accessible,
high-quality interfaces.
● Uphold engineering standards: code quality, CI/CD, testing, and release
practices.
● Contribute to technical direction and roadmap discussions with the Director of
Technology and founders.
● Use AI tools throughout your own workflow — for planning, coding, testing and
review — to accelerate delivery without compromising quality.
● Continuously look for better ways of working — in your process, your tools and
your output
Profile
● 5+ years’ experience of shipping production software end-to-end as a senior
engineer.
● Strong Python backend development experience in scalable (5+ years),
production systems, including distributed systems, asynchronous architectures
and APIs.
● Strong TypeScript (2+ years) and modern front-end development experience
(React).
● Solid hands-on AWS experience (5+ years), with working knowledge of
Terraform, Kubernetes and EKS.
● Hands-on experience developing software using Claude Code or similar AI
coding agents, running them in automated loops and using them to drive 80%+ of
the SDLC (planning, coding, testing, review).
● Professional experience with LLM-based systems or AI/ML product development.
● Comfortable owning full-stack architecture decisions for the features you deliver.
● Comfort operating in an early-stage, fast-changing environment, where priorities
shift and ambiguity is normal — someone who leans into that rather than waiting
for certainty.
● Excellent collaboration skills, working as an equal partner to both product and
design.
● Master’s degree in a STEM field (Computer Science, Software Engineering, or
related discipline).
● Nice to have: experience in governance, compliance, security, or regulated
industries.
● Nice to have: prior experience at an early-stage startup, ideally pre-Series A.
